Tottenham supremo Levy keeps tabs on Wolves’ Nuno amid Mourinho doubt

Jose Mourinho’s future at Tottenham is depending on whether he delivers Champions League football as Daniel Levy is interested in the Wolves manager.

Tottenham

are eyeing

Nuno Espirito Santo

as a possible successor for

Jose Mourinho

. The Portuguese boss’s future is at stake if he does not lead his side to the top of the table and qualify for the Champions League.

Tottenham chairman Levy has been keen on acquiring the

Wolves

manager’s services. Nuno’s contract is due to expire in 2023 but he has been targeted for a move away and his compensation package will be around £8m.

Although Wolves have fallen down on the

Premier League

table, Nuno’s reputation did not take a hit.

Reports state that Nuno is looking for another club as he asked his agent Jorge Mendes.

Tottenham have been defeated 3-1 at the hands of Manchester United which saw them fall six points behind West Ham.
